{"id":1027,"date":"2018-12-03T11:33:20","date_gmt":"2018-12-03T02:33:20","guid":{"rendered":"https:\/\/vongg.com\/?p=1027"},"modified":"2018-12-03T11:36:31","modified_gmt":"2018-12-03T02:36:31","slug":"oracle-db-info-list","status":"publish","type":"post","link":"https:\/\/vongg.com\/?p=1027","title":{"rendered":"oracle objectList"},"content":{"rendered":"<p>object_list.sql:<br \/>\nset pagesize 0<br \/>\nset serveroutput on<br \/>\nset linesize 32767<br \/>\nset trimspool on<br \/>\nset heading on<br \/>\nset feedback off<br \/>\nset verify off<br \/>\nset echo off<br \/>\nset long 2000000000<\/p>\n<p>spool .\\[&amp;_USER.]object_list.csv<br \/>\nSELECT &#8216;OBJECT\u540d&#8217; || &#8216;,&#8217; || &#8216;OBJECT\u30bf\u30a4\u30d7&#8217; || &#8216;,&#8217; || &#8216;\u72b6\u614b&#8217; FROM DUAL;<br \/>\nSELECT OBJECT_NAME || &#8216;,&#8217; || OBJECT_TYPE || &#8216;,&#8217; || STATUS FROM ALL_OBJECTS WHERE OWNER = &#8216;&amp;_USER&#8217; AND OBJECT_TYPE = &#8216;SYNONYM&#8217; ORDER BY OBJECT_NAME;<br \/>\nSELECT OBJECT_NAME || &#8216;,&#8217; || OBJECT_TYPE || &#8216;,&#8217; || STATUS FROM ALL_OBJECTS WHERE OWNER = &#8216;&amp;_USER&#8217; AND OBJECT_TYPE = &#8216;TABLE&#8217; ORDER BY OBJECT_NAME;<br \/>\nSELECT OBJECT_NAME || &#8216;,&#8217; || OBJECT_TYPE || &#8216;,&#8217; || STATUS FROM ALL_OBJECTS WHERE OWNER = &#8216;&amp;_USER&#8217; AND OBJECT_TYPE = &#8216;SEQUENCE&#8217; ORDER BY OBJECT_NAME;<br \/>\nSELECT OBJECT_NAME || &#8216;,&#8217; || OBJECT_TYPE || &#8216;,&#8217; || STATUS FROM ALL_OBJECTS WHERE OWNER = &#8216;&amp;_USER&#8217; AND OBJECT_TYPE = &#8216;VIEW&#8217; ORDER BY OBJECT_NAME;<br \/>\nSELECT OBJECT_NAME || &#8216;,&#8217; || OBJECT_TYPE || &#8216;,&#8217; || STATUS FROM ALL_OBJECTS WHERE OWNER = &#8216;&amp;_USER&#8217; AND OBJECT_TYPE = &#8216;PACKAGE&#8217; ORDER BY OBJECT_NAME;<br \/>\nSELECT OBJECT_NAME || &#8216;,&#8217; || OBJECT_TYPE || &#8216;,&#8217; || STATUS FROM ALL_OBJECTS WHERE OWNER = &#8216;&amp;_USER&#8217; AND OBJECT_TYPE = &#8216;PACKAGE BODY&#8217; ORDER BY OBJECT_NAME;<br \/>\nSELECT OBJECT_NAME || &#8216;,&#8217; || OBJECT_TYPE || &#8216;,&#8217; || STATUS FROM ALL_OBJECTS WHERE OWNER = &#8216;&amp;_USER&#8217; AND OBJECT_TYPE = &#8216;TRIGGER&#8217; ORDER BY OBJECT_NAME;<br \/>\nspool off<\/p>\n<p>spool .\\[&amp;_USER.]table_column_list.csv<br \/>\nSELECT &#8216;\u30c6\u30fc\u30d6\u30eb\u540d&#8217; || &#8216;,&#8217; || &#8216;\u5217\u540d&#8217; || &#8216;,&#8217; || &#8216;\u30c7\u30fc\u30bf\u578b&#8217; || &#8216;,&#8217; || &#8216;\u9577\u3055&#8217; || &#8216;,&#8217; || &#8216;\u5c0f\u6570\u90e8&#8217; || &#8216;,&#8217; || &#8216;NULL\u53ef&#8217; FROM DUAL;<br \/>\nSELECT TABLE_NAME || &#8216;,&#8217; || COLUMN_NAME || &#8216;,&#8217; || DATA_TYPE || &#8216;,&#8217; || NVL(DATA_PRECISION, CHAR_COL_DECL_LENGTH) || &#8216;,&#8217; || DATA_SCALE || &#8216;,&#8217; || NULLABLE FROM USER_TAB_COLUMNS ORDER BY TABLE_NAME,COLUMN_NAME;<br \/>\nspool off<\/p>\n<p>spool .\\[&amp;_USER.]index_list.csv<br \/>\nSELECT &#8216;\u30a4\u30f3\u30c7\u30c3\u30af\u30b9\u540d&#8217; || &#8216;,&#8217; || &#8216;\u5217\u540d&#8217; || &#8216;,&#8217; || &#8216;\u30a4\u30f3\u30c7\u30c3\u30af\u30b9\u30bf\u30a4\u30d7&#8217; || &#8216;,&#8217; || &#8216;\u30c6\u30fc\u30d6\u30eb\u540d&#8217; || &#8216;,&#8217; || &#8216;UNIQUE\/NONUNIQUE&#8217; || &#8216;,&#8217; || &#8216;\u72b6\u614b&#8217; FROM DUAL;<br \/>\nSELECT<br \/>\nA.INDEX_NAME\u00a0\u00a0\u00a0\u00a0\u00a0\u00a0\u00a0 || &#8216;,&#8217; ||<br \/>\nB.COLUMN_NAME\u00a0\u00a0\u00a0\u00a0\u00a0\u00a0 || &#8216;,&#8217; ||<br \/>\nA.INDEX_TYPE\u00a0\u00a0\u00a0\u00a0\u00a0\u00a0\u00a0 || &#8216;,&#8217; ||<br \/>\nA.TABLE_NAME\u00a0\u00a0\u00a0\u00a0\u00a0\u00a0\u00a0 || &#8216;,&#8217; ||<br \/>\nA.UNIQUENESS\u00a0\u00a0\u00a0\u00a0\u00a0\u00a0\u00a0 || &#8216;,&#8217; ||<br \/>\n&#8212;\u00a0\u00a0\u00a0 A.TABLESPACE_NAME\u00a0\u00a0 || &#8216;,&#8217; ||<br \/>\n&#8212;\u00a0\u00a0\u00a0 A.TABLE_OWNER\u00a0\u00a0\u00a0\u00a0\u00a0\u00a0 || &#8216;,&#8217; ||<br \/>\nA.STATUS<br \/>\nFROM<br \/>\nUSER_INDEXES\u00a0\u00a0\u00a0\u00a0\u00a0\u00a0\u00a0 A<br \/>\n, USER_IND_COLUMNS\u00a0\u00a0\u00a0 B<br \/>\nWHERE<br \/>\nA.INDEX_NAME = B.INDEX_NAME<br \/>\nORDER BY<br \/>\nA.TABLE_NAME<br \/>\n, A.UNIQUENESS DESC<br \/>\n, B.COLUMN_NAME;<br \/>\nspool off<\/p>\n<p>spool .\\[&amp;_USER.]source.txt<br \/>\nSELECT TEXT FROM USER_SOURCE ORDER BY NAME,TYPE,LINE;<br \/>\nspool off<\/p>\n<p>exit<\/p>\n","protected":false},"excerpt":{"rendered":"<p>object_list.sql: set pagesize 0 set serveroutput on set [&hellip;]<\/p>\n","protected":false},"author":1,"featured_media":0,"comment_status":"open","ping_status":"open","sticky":false,"template":"","format":"standard","meta":[],"categories":[22],"tags":[],"_links":{"self":[{"href":"https:\/\/vongg.com\/index.php?rest_route=\/wp\/v2\/posts\/1027"}],"collection":[{"href":"https:\/\/vongg.com\/index.php?rest_route=\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/vongg.com\/index.php?rest_route=\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/vongg.com\/index.php?rest_route=\/wp\/v2\/users\/1"}],"replies":[{"embeddable":true,"href":"https:\/\/vongg.com\/index.php?rest_route=%2Fwp%2Fv2%2Fcomments&post=1027"}],"version-history":[{"count":2,"href":"https:\/\/vongg.com\/index.php?rest_route=\/wp\/v2\/posts\/1027\/revisions"}],"predecessor-version":[{"id":1029,"href":"https:\/\/vongg.com\/index.php?rest_route=\/wp\/v2\/posts\/1027\/revisions\/1029"}],"wp:attachment":[{"href":"https:\/\/vongg.com\/index.php?rest_route=%2Fwp%2Fv2%2Fmedia&parent=1027"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/vongg.com\/index.php?rest_route=%2Fwp%2Fv2%2Fcategories&post=1027"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/vongg.com\/index.php?rest_route=%2Fwp%2Fv2%2Ftags&post=1027"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}